Question

A chemical reaction in which the rate of reaction is directly proportional to the first power of the concentration of the reacting substance is called:

This question was previously asked in
SSC CGL 2024 (Tier-I) Previous Year Paper (17-Sep-2024) (Shift 3)
The correct answer is

first order reaction

A chemical reaction where the rate is directly proportional to the first power of the concentration of the reacting substance is called a first order reaction.
